What happened on October 19?

Here's what happened on October 19th in history:


  • 2022: During the ongoing Russo-Ukrainian War, Russian forces began evacuating thousands of civilians from occupied areas of Kherson Oblast. Ukrainian authorities urged residents to disregard Russian evacuation orders. Simultaneously, Russian President Vladimir Putin declared martial law in recently annexed Ukrainian territories and raised the preparedness level in Crimea and border regions.
  • 2017: A Taliban attack on an Army Base in Kandahar Province resulted in the deaths of at least 43 Afghan soldiers and approximately 10 Taliban fighters, highlighting ongoing conflict in Afghanistan.
  • 2016: A natural gas explosion occurred in downtown Portland, Oregon, causing damage to several buildings and injuring eight people.
  • 2012: Wissam Al-Hassan, a key security official for Saad Al-Hariri and chief investigator in the Michel Samaha bombing investigation, was killed in the blast. His death was significant in the context of Lebanon's complex political landscape and Syrian-Lebanese relations.
  • 2009: Commemoration of Joseph Wiseman, a notable Canadian actor born in 1918, who contributed to the performing arts throughout his career.
  • 2005: The Houston Astros baseball team achieved a historic milestone by winning their first National League Championship, advancing to their inaugural World Series in franchise history. This momentous achievement represented a significant breakthrough for the team.
  • 2003: Alija Izetbegović, a key political figure in Bosnia and Herzegovina's history and a prominent leader during the Bosnian War, passes away. He was instrumental in Bosnia's independence and post-war reconstruction.
  • 1980: Steve McPeak set a remarkable world record by riding a unicycle to an extraordinary height of 101 feet and 9 inches, demonstrating exceptional balance, skill, and daring in an unprecedented athletic achievement.
  • 1979: On October 19, 1979, a tragic fire at Camp Fuji, Japan claimed the lives of 13 U.S. Marines during the devastating Typhoon Tip. The extreme weather conditions and subsequent fire resulted in significant loss of life for the U.S. Marine Corps, highlighting the dangerous conditions military personnel can face during natural disasters.
  • 1974: The Detroit Pistons defeated the Portland Trail Blazers in an away game in Portland, marking a notable basketball match in the 1974 NBA season.
